Chaukihasan Chauki Makhdum
Chaukihasan Chauki Makhdum is a village located in Barharia subdivision of Siwan district in Bihar, India. It is situated 6km away from sub-district headquarter Barharia (tehsildar office) and 20km away from district headquarter Siwan. As per 2009 stats, Chauki Hasan is the gram panchayat of Chaukihasan Chauki Makhdum village.

About Chaukihasan Chauki Makhdum
According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Chaukihasan Chauki Makhdum is 231544. The village spans a total geographical area of 573 hectares. Siwan is nearest town to Chaukihasan Chauki Makhdum village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 20km away.

Population of Chaukihasan Chauki Makhdum
Below is a concise population overview of Chaukihasan Chauki Makhdum as per the Census 2011 data. The table highlights the key population metrics categorized by gender and social groups.
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total Population | 10,197 | 5,218 | 4,979 |
Child Population (0–6 yrs) | 1,811 | 974 | 837 |
Scheduled Castes (SC) | 688 | 358 | 330 |
Scheduled Tribes (ST) | 243 | 113 | 130 |
Literate Population | 5,707 | 3,392 | 2,315 |
Illiterate Population | 4,490 | 1,826 | 2,664 |
Here's a detailed summary of the Basic Population Details of Chaukihasan Chauki Makhdum village:
- The total population of Chaukihasan Chauki Makhdum village is around 10,197, including approximately 5,218 males and 4,979 females, with a sex ratio of 954 females per 1,000 males.
- There are about 1,811 children aged 0–6 years in Chaukihasan Chauki Makhdum village, reflecting the young population in the village.
- Chaukihasan Chauki Makhdum village has 688 people belonging to the Scheduled Castes (SC) and 243 residents from the Scheduled Tribes (ST).
- The literacy rate of Chaukihasan Chauki Makhdum village is about 55.97%, with male literacy at 65.01% and female literacy at 46.50%.
- There are around 1,507 households in Chaukihasan Chauki Makhdum village.
Connectivity of Chaukihasan Chauki Makhdum
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Chaukihasan Chauki Makhdum. As per the 2011 stats, Chaukihasan Chauki Makhdum had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.
Connectivity Type | Status (in year 2011) |
---|---|
Public Bus Service | Available within 5 - 10 km distance |
Private Bus Service | Available within village |
Railway Station | Available within 10+ km distance |
